use std::process::Command;
pub fn get_gpus() -> Vec<String> {
let output = Command::new("lspci")
.arg("-mm")
.output()
.ok()
.and_then(|o| String::from_utf8(o.stdout).ok())
.unwrap_or_default();
let mut gpus = vec![];
for line in output.lines() {
if line.contains("\"VGA") || line.contains("\"3D") || line.contains("\"Display") {
let parts: Vec<&str> = line.split('"').collect();
if parts.len() >= 6 {
let vendor = parts[3].replace("Corporation", "").trim().to_string();
let model = parts[5].trim().to_string();
let full = format!("{} {}", vendor, model);
if !gpus.contains(&full) {
gpus.push(full);
}
}
}
}
if gpus.is_empty() {
vec!["Unknown GPU".to_string()]
} else {
gpus
}
}
